HomeMy WebLinkAbout021852 ORD - 01/11/1994AN ORDINANCE AMENDING THE ZONING ORDINANCE UPON APPLICATION BY RICHARD CRUZ BY CHANGING THE ZONING MAP IN REFERENCE TO LEXINGTON SUBDIVISION, BLOCK 2, LOT 50B, FROM "R -Ir ONE - FAMILY DWELLING DISTRICT TO 13-1" NEIGHBORHOOD BUSINESS DISTRICT; PROVIDING FOR PUBLICATION; AND DECLARING AN EMERGENCY. WHFREAS, the Planning Commission has forwarded to the City Council its reports and recommendations concerning the application of Richard Cruz for amendment to the zoning map of the City of Corpus Christi; WHEREAS, in accordance with proper notice to the public, a public hearing was held on Wednesday, December 1, 1993, during a meeting of the Planning Commission and on Tuesday, January 11, 1994, during a meeting of the City Council, in the Council Chambers at City Hall in the City of Corpus Christi allowing all interested persons to appear and be heard; and WHEREAS, the City Council has determined that the hereinafter set forth amendment would best serve public health, necessity and convenience and the general welfare of the City of Corpus Christi and its citizens. NOW, THEREFORE, BE IT ORDAINED BY THE CITY COUNCIL OF THE CITY OF CORPUS CHRISTI, TEXAS: SECTION 1. That the Zoning Ordinance of the City of Corpus Christi, Texas, is amended by making the change hereinafter set out. SECTION 2. That the zoning of Lexington Subdivision, Block 2, Lot 50B, located on the north side of Milo Street, approximately 200 feet east of Ayers Street, be changed from 'R -1B" One -family Dwelling District to 'B -P" Neighborhood Business District. SECTION 3. That the official zoning map of the City of Corpus Christi, Texas, be and the same is hereby amended as herein ordained. SECTION 4. That the Zoning Ordinance and Map of the City of Corpus Christi, Texas, approved on the 27th day of August, 1973, as amended from time to time, except as herein changed, shall remain in full force and effect. SECTION 5. That all ordinances or parts of ordinances in conflict herewith are hereby expressly repealed. 93NH2889.065.ak 1193-2 ill S-32 2 SECTION 6. That, to the extent that the amendment to the Zoning Ordinance set forth hereinabove represents a deviation from the Comprehensive Plan, the Comprehensive Plan is hereby amended to conform to the Zoning Ordinance as amended herein. SECTION 7. Publication shall be made in the official publication of the City of Corpus Christi as required by the City Charter of the City of Corpus Christi. SECTION S.
